Guns n Roses @ Monsters of Rock, Donington, August 1988 – Playing alongside KISS and Iron Maiden at the British festival, tragedy struck during Guns N Roses' set. The 100,000 capacity crowd began to push forward, causing Axl Rose to plead with them to stop. Unfortunately it was to no avail and two audience members were trampled to death. Despite the band's efforts, certain sections of the media partially blamed them for the deaths as they continued to play when the crowd first surged forward.
